Requirements
  • Seven to ten years of electrical knowledge and experience, with ten years listed under education and experience.
  • Previous electrical or electronic trade experience or training.
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ints and electrical schematics.
  • Familiarity with a wide range of hand tools, power tools, testing equipment, and software used for planning and documentation.
  • Ability to diagnose complex electrical issues and implement efficient, code-compliant solutions.
  • Ability to frequently carry up to 25 pounds and push or pull more than 25 pounds.
  • Availability to work all shifts.
  • Ability to work at heights, in confined spaces, and in extreme temperature conditions as required.
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• At least 18 years of age, except where a higher age is required by law.
  • Applicable journeyman licensure requirements.
  • Journey or Master electrician certification or license.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Microsoft Excel, and Adobe.
Responsibilities
  • Interpret blueprints, schematics, and technical diagrams.
  • Work with high- and low-voltage systems.
  • Fabricate and install wire-way hangers.
  • Install conduit below and above ground.
  • Install cables of assorted sizes and types for lighting, communications, control, power, and electronics.
  • Install terminal boxes, switches, controllers, wiring harnesses, cabinets, and other components for various electrical systems.
  • Install main power switchboards and electrical equipment.
  • Cut in and hook up cables for installed components.
  • Follow the National Electrical Code and local regulations.
  • Oversee job sites, coordinate with other trades, and provide guidance to apprentices and junior electricians.
